Tatari
Tatari is a village located in Purulia Ii subdivision of Puruliya district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 9.3km away from Purulia,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Tatari village. As per 2009 stats, Ghonga is the gram panchayat of Tatari village.

About Tatari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tatari is 329911. The village spans a total geographical area of 124.24 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 723149. Purulia is nearest town to Tatari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Tatari
According to the 2011 Census, Tatari has a total population of about 1,696, with approximately 894 males and 802 females. The sex ratio is around 897 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 368 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 26.00%, with male literacy at about 35.57% and female literacy near 15.34%. There are around 274 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Tatari's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,696 | 894 | 802 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 368 | 204 | 164 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 441 | 318 | 123 |
Illiterate Population | 1,255 | 576 | 679 |
Connectivity of Tatari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tatari. As per the 2011 stats, Tatari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within village |
